Abstract

Thermal barrier coatings (TBCs) are widely used in aero-engine because of their excellent properties such as low thermal conductivity, high temperature resistance, corrosion resistance, oxidation resistance, and abrasion resistance. TBCs can effectively protect the hot end parts made of nickel-based superalloys. The service temperature and service life of the hot end components are improved, and the efficiency of the gas engine is increased. Compared with traditional thermal barrier coating materials, high entropy alloys and high entropy ceramic have better thermal stability, oxidation resistance, corrosion resistance, and phase stability, which have become a research hotspot of new TBCs materials for aero-engines. The definition and connotation of high entropy alloys are summarized. The research status of high entropy thermal barrier coatings is introduced, including coatings' design principles and preparation technologies, domestic and abroad development status, and the research and application prospect of high entropy thermal barrier coatings are prospected
